What Resolution is the DR. J Projector?
If you are looking for an affordable yet powerful projector, the DR. J projector may just be what you need. With its compact size and long-lasting lamp life, it is a great choice for movie nights, presentations, and gaming. Its resolution determines the clarity of the images projected, so its important to know what resolution the DR. J projector has.
The DR. J projector has a native resolution of 1280 x 720 pixels. This resolution is also known as HD (high definition), and it produces clear and detailed images. It is not as high as Full HD (1920 x 1080 pixels), but it still exceeds the quality of standard definition (480p) projectors.
One of the benefits of having an HD projector is that it can display content in widescreen format, allowing you to see more detail and a wider range of colors. It is also great for streaming movies or playing games in high definition, as it provides a cinematic experience even in a small space.
The DR. J projector uses an LED light source, which can last up to 70,000 hours. This means that you can enjoy your projector for years without needing to replace the lamp. The projector also has a brightness of 4500 lumens, making it suitable for use in well-lit rooms.
The DR. J projector is easy to set up and use, and it comes with a range of connectivity options, including HDMI, VGA, USB, and AV. You can connect it to your laptop, smartphone, or gaming console, and enjoy your favorite content on a large screen.
